Hi does anyone know how to delete unused tags in Crimson 3.0? Using the function "find unused tags" goes one by one and the results are not correct, the first folder I deleted was being used and showed a DB Error right away.
 
After clicking the link to find unused tags, press F8 to show the results in a list. If the unused tag is inside a folder, the folder will be highlighted rather than the unused tag within it. Double clicking items in the results list will navigate the cursor to the individual items.

EDIT: Also be aware that what is identified as unused really means that it is not linked to a display object or other tag. For example, there might be tags that are only used as alarm triggers that get flagged as unused.
